Raglan's Hero Characteristics

  • Most heroic according to Raglan: Theseus
  • Characteristics that apply to Theseus:
    • Mother is a royal virgin
    • Father is a king
    • Unusual circumstances of conception
    • Reputed son of a god
    • Spirited away in childhood
    • Minimal details about childhood
    • Returns to his future kingdom upon reaching manhood
    • Victorious over a king or beast
    • Marries a princess, often his predecessor's daughter
    • Becomes king and prescribes laws
    • Loses favor with gods/subjects
    • Driven from throne and city
    • Meets mysterious death
